Listers now supplies Gallery Gripcore doors. MD Roy Frost explained why: “The main irritation with any door installation are the callbacks to site. You want to fit and forget, which is what you can do with Gallery Gripcore doors because of the advanced technology in their construction.”

Gallery Gripcore doors from Doorco are made using a hybrid of cross-laminated engineered hardwood, laminated veneer lumber (LVL) timber, and hardwood stiles and rails, then pressed with 4mm GRP skins. Thanks to this robust design, doors will not move, bow or twist more than 3mm. They will also require minimal maintenance and are said to be more secure than many alternatives.

Roy concluded: “We know that homeowners are looking to improve the thermal efficiency of their homes as the cost of energy continues to increase. And, as Gallery Gripcore doors are warmer and stronger than many doors on the market, our customers have a great opportunity to meet a real demand for high value high margin products.

“And because Gallery Gripcore doors resist warping and cracking, that margin stays with the installer, and is not wasted returning to site to deal with performance issues.”
